How AI Is Changing WordPress Website Development
AI-driven WordPress development has come with many changes:

1. AI Website Builders
The AI website builders within WordPress first get to understand user goals, industry, and audience, and use that data to generate layouts, color schemes, typography, and content structure. While using the AI WordPress tools as a web developer, you get suggestions for optimized layouts, design patterns, responsive UI structures, etc.
2. Improve User Experience
AI for WordPress checks how users engage with a website through analytics to enhance user experience. As a web developer using the tools, you will get suggestions on call-to-action placements, optimized page layout, design adoption, and better optimization of the website.
AI-powered WordPress websites can show personalized content based on visitor behavior, recommend related posts or products, adjust layouts and calls to action, and deliver region-specific experiences. The feature can help online store owners determine which products are doing better and analyse and evaluate which products to sell more or market.
3. AI Automation
AI tools in WordPress help reduce the time that could be used for some WordPress processes. These include tasks such as content scheduling, content generation, internal linking, performance optimization, image optimization, security monitoring, performance caching, etc.
4. Content Creation and Optimization
AI tools integrated into WordPress can generate blog drafts based on topic prompts, rewrite content for enhanced clarity, suggest SEO friendly headlines and meta descriptions, and improve readability.
This is mainly through understanding context, brand voice, and user intent, which can improve readability and consistency when reviewed by an editor.
5. Smarter SEO and Search Engine Visibility
The AI-enhanced WordPress tools can analyze keyword intent, predict ranking opportunities, optimize internal linking, and suggest content structures.
6. AI-Assisted Website Design
Unlike previously, when as a web developer, you would have to start the website or online store development from scratch, nowadays AI tools assist with layout suggestions, recommending color schemes, recommending typography combinations, adjusting spacing, and creating block patterns based on your user goals.
AI plugins such as AI Engine and AI Block Editor integrate directly with Gutenberg, which helps developers design pages within the block editor.
7. Automated Maintenance
AI is being adopted in WordPress maintenance workflows as it regularly detects performance issues, optimizes images & assets automatically, identifies unused plugins, and monitors uptime. Since people disregard routine maintenance until a glitch occurs, AI-driven monitoring can help keep the site operational and performant.
8. Security and Threat Detection
AI can help to identify suspicious login behavior, detect malware patterns, block brute force attacks, and monitor file changes in real time. The advantage of AI is that it learns from behavioral patterns.
9. eCommerce Enhancements in WooCommerce
AI is changing how online stores operate, especially those with WooCommerce. With plugins such as WooCommerce AI addons, AI content generator, and Yoast WooCommerce SEO, you can generate optimized product descriptions, get recommendations on products based on customer behavior, inventory and stock management, personalized pricing and offers, and abandoned-cart recovery messages.
This reduces manual work for eCommerce developers, while helping store owners to make smarter business decisions.
10. Intelligent Analytics
AI-powered analytics tools such as Monsterinsights integrated with WordPress can identify content that drives conversions, detect drop-off points in user journeys, forecast traffic and engagement trends, and suggest improvements based on performance data.
11. Code Generation
AI tools can generate custom PHP, JavaScript, and CSS snippets, debugging errors in theme and plugin development, and providing suggestions for optimizing performance.
It can support full website management, content planning, and custom block generation.

Will WordPress Survive The AI Evolution?
AI has major advantages, but comes with challenges of over-automation, generic content, and data privacy concerns.
We should treat it as a supplement to human creativity and expertise, not a replacement for it.
Developers and store owners can use AI to reduce repetitive work and free up time for strategy and custom development. AI still requires human oversight for custom development, troubleshooting, security, and business-specific requirements.
Moreover, WordPress is likely to remain relevant because businesses still need customization, integrations, governance, and technical oversight. Also, AI models depend on training data, and there is a high chance they will generate incorrect or unreliable outputs if the data used in WordPress development is inaccurate or outdated.

Developers are still needed to review AI outputs for bias, accuracy, and data privacy.
Additionally, relying too much on AI can make websites feel impersonal or repetitive. This can lead to a disconnected user experience. AI tools can assist with code, but require review before deployment.
Also, you should only use AI for most generic code and not specific hooks or tweaking specific plugins since it cannot be fully accurate. You can use AI for content and SEO optimization if you write the prompts well for content, meta descriptions, and keyword strategies.

Keynote: Best Practices for Using AI in WordPress Projects
WordPress development remains relevant alongside AI for several reasons:
- You need to test AI-generated code before use.
- It is not recommended to overload your website with AI features, and don’t overuse AI-generated content.
- AI suggestions for specific plugins may not always be accurate, so cross-check them against the plugin’s official documentation.
- AI can give general background on plugins and themes, but check official documentation for current features and setup details.
- AI-generated translations can contain errors, so review them before publishing.
- AI can help draft custom plugin code, but developers still need WordPress-specific knowledge to review, test, and refine it before deployment.
- Be mindful of AI licensing and copyright terms, since AI-generated content and code may carry usage restrictions.
